Design and Features
The design of the University of Sheffield PhD gown is steeped in tradition, yet it also incorporates elements that distinguish it from other doctoral gowns. Typically, the gown is made from a high-quality black fabric, often Russell Cord or a similar material known for its durability and elegant drape. The sleeves are a defining feature, usually long and closed, with a distinctive bell shape or a full, gathered style. These sleeves often feature decorative elements such as panels or chevrons in a faculty color, adding a touch of personalization and indicating the wearer's field of study. The gown's front is typically unadorned, maintaining a classic and formal appearance suitable for academic ceremonies.

Cleaning and Storage
To maintain the pristine condition of your University of Sheffield PhD gown, proper cleaning and storage are essential. After each use, gently brush the gown to remove any dust or debris. For minor stains, spot clean with a mild detergent and a soft cloth. Avoid using harsh chemicals or bleach, as they can damage the fabric and affect the color. For more significant stains or soiling, consider professional dry cleaning. When storing your gown, use a garment bag to protect it from dust, moths, and other environmental factors. Ensure the gown is completely dry before storing it to prevent mildew. Hang the gown on a padded hanger to maintain its shape and prevent wrinkles. Avoid storing the gown in direct sunlight or in a humid environment, as this can cause fading and damage. Accessorizing Your Gown
When wearing your University of Sheffield PhD gown, consider the appropriate accessories to complete your academic attire. The hood is an essential component, with its colors and lining indicating your university and faculty. Ensure the hood is properly draped over your shoulders, with the lining visible. A mortarboard or Tudor bonnet is traditionally worn as headwear, adding to the formal appearance. Some graduates choose to wear a doctoral tam, a soft velvet hat with a gold tassel. Coordinate your accessories to match the gown and hood, maintaining a cohesive and respectful look. Avoid wearing overly casual or distracting items that detract from the formality of the occasion. Simple, understated jewelry is acceptable, but large or flashy pieces should be avoided.
